Kooga will supply Tigers next season following kit bags decision not to renew with Canterbury again.

A mix of poor sales and a failed sales plan saw Canterbury looking to leave the deal and Kit bag have chosen to go with Kooga following a closed tender process.

Rumours are a return to a two year shirt cycle following Canterburys failed attempts to introduce an annual change which saw overall sales figures fall dramatically.

Sorry to jump in..couple of threads I'd like to comment on if that's ok - this is one - I'm a Scarlets supporter, and we have Kooga this year (Burrda previously). The 4 Welsh regions signed up with BLK (effectively Kooga Australia) for 3 years a few months ago -- not sure how or why but the Scarlets are 'Kooga' and the other regions 'BLK'...anyway the kit design has generally been well received but the replica gear and general merchandise not so...prices are low (replica shirt is £45) but material and make up reflects the price too..

The Scarlets shop is also run and staffed by Kooga...those of you who were at the ground last weekend can comment further, but the offer is restricted and un-imagaintive in my view...

Most of the rugby brands (Kooga, Canterbury, Kuqri) are owned by the same parent company these days and tend to be a bit 'samey', only the likes of Adidas, Nike, Burrda and Under Armour trade alone..
